由表5.1可以看出,加入高吸水性树脂后,流出水量减少,所以土壤保水能力增强,也可看出添加吸水树脂后,水向下渗漏的速度变慢,是因为吸水树脂与其周围的土壤颗粒交联在一起,形成了一层隔水层,从而阻止了水分向下渗透,因此,实验出水时间越长,流出水量越少,表明其保水能力越强。
